3 Possums in a Trenchcoat

great chill coffee (and other drinks!) spot. there's lots of gluten-free products which are kept in a separate case to the non-GF products, which is fantastic. The staff is always happy to help and the service is very fast, and I've never had issues with my orders. I highly recommend the frozen hot chocolate personally, and it's super nice being able to have something with the rest of the group when you aren't a big coffee drinker. The atmosphere is casual but comfortable and there's a range of seating available too. Definitely 10/10!

Ashley Nowak

Coffee is very good, & they offer gluten free bakery items. Outdoor seating is nice & downtown location is great. Indoor space is very open and loud. The ambiance is harsh and sterile. Diffucult to take a call or have a conversation without everyone hearing everyone else. Would love to see a more comfortable and inviting indoor seating environment typical of other cafes.
